I had been wanting to visit Mint Rd at the Narrabundah shops for a while, and finally had the chance one warm Saturday morning. It was evident that this is a popular spot with regular customers, as the staff were friendly and knew many customers by name. The cozy atmosphere of the small space gave it a welcoming, community feel. The breakfast menu was simple and straightforward, with no fancy dishes. I opted for the bacon and egg roll ($6.50) and a Noah's apple and peach juice ($4) - although there was no fresh juice available. My roll was served quickly and I was impressed with the quality.
